以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  高级功能研发区  (http://weistock.com/bbs/list.asp?boardid=5)
----  创建了一个很简单的类模块,为什么第二行就提示语法错误  (http://weistock.com/bbs/dispbbs.asp?boardid=5&id=48703)

--  作者:chenjun25825
--  发布时间:2013/2/20 14:11:15
--  创建了一个很简单的类模块,为什么第二行就提示语法错误

 class HeyueInformatio   
        public  jiamastate
        public publicenterdirection
        public publicmarketname
        public heyuename
        public enterprice
        public addprice,chicang
        public erdu
        public sellprice
        public  ATRS
    
         Private Sub Class_Initialize()
         end sub
        Private Sub class_terminate()

         end sub
 
      end class


--  作者:chenjun25825
--  发布时间:2013/2/20 15:05:20
--  
提示的是  VBA编译器错误"1002",语法错误
--  作者:admin
--  发布时间:2013/2/20 15:18:18
--  

要看你在什么地方创建的.

如果在类模块中,是不需要声明 class  的.


--  作者:chenjun25825
--  发布时间:2013/2/20 15:27:16
--  
那是个什么格式啊,麻烦简单写下
--  作者:chenjun25825
--  发布时间:2013/2/20 15:29:50
--  
直接定义变量 属性和方法吗?不用 class  和end class?
--  作者:admin
--  发布时间:2013/2/20 15:31:33
--  
是的
--  作者:chenjun25825
--  发布时间:2013/2/20 15:38:22
--  

能不能定义一个数组,其类型为自定义类,比如类为HeyueInformatio  redim preserve chicanginfor(index)
               set chicanginfor(index)=New HeyueInformatio
个数组,其对象为一个自定义类